Transaction 18f138f429eeb34e648ef499c7508ab797183931647207e7b118f41c20c880ae
1 Input
1 Output
-
18f138f429eeb34e648ef499c7508ab797183931647207e7b118f41c20c880ae:0
- value
- 605013
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72942f7f51aa0346ee3718bd2b589ed559dd42be OP_EQUAL
- address
- 3C8rUXLzFMXZdXFi1K4cDtejEVRfWyvgnW